Guanhua Sun is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law and Mechanics of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Guanhua Sun has authored 76 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 42 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 35 papers in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law and 31 papers in Mechanics of Materials. Recurrent topics in Guanhua Sun's work include Landslides and related hazards (35 papers), Geotechnical Engineering and Analysis (30 papers) and Dam Engineering and Safety (30 papers). Guanhua Sun is often cited by papers focused on Landslides and related hazards (35 papers), Geotechnical Engineering and Analysis (30 papers) and Dam Engineering and Safety (30 papers). Guanhua Sun collaborates with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and United States. Guanhua Sun's co-authors include Hong Zheng, Yongtao Yang, Chengzeng Yan, Xiurun Ge, Wei Jiang, Defu Liu, Tan Sui, Yaoying Huang, Hong Zheng and Chunguang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Geophysical Journal International and International Journal for Numerical Methods in Engineering.
